Expected Value Analysis of the Welcome Bonus

Let’s run the numbers on the Spinyoo welcome offer to see what it’s actually worth. Assume a £20 deposit triggering a £20 bonus and 50 free spins valued at £0.10 each (£5 total). The bonus wagering requirement is 10x on the £20 bonus, giving a turnover target of £200. If you play slots with a 96% RTP (4% house edge), the expected cost of meeting the wagering is £200 × 4% = £8. The free spins carry their own 10x wagering on winnings. If the free spins produce an average win of £3 (a reasonable estimate given the 96% RTP and 50 spins at 10p), the wagering on that £3 is £30, costing another £1.20 in expected loss. Total expected cost: £9.20. The total bonus value is £20 + £3 = £23. So the expected value is £23 − £9.20 = £13.80. That’s a solid return for a £20 deposit, though remember that these are averages — individual results will vary wildly. The key takeaway is that the bonus has positive expected value, which is increasingly rare under the 10x cap.

Casino Economics — How the Offer Benefits the Operator

From the operator’s perspective, the welcome bonus is a customer acquisition cost. Spinyoo budgets for a certain percentage of players to complete the wagering and withdraw, while another percentage will lose their bonus funds before meeting the turnover target. The 10x wagering requirement, combined with the 4% house edge on slots, means the casino expects to retain around 40% of the bonus value on average. That is a reasonable margin for a regulated market. The free spins cost the operator very little — they are essentially a marketing expense paid at a discounted rate to the game provider. The real profit comes from players who deposit again after the bonus is exhausted, which is why the platform focuses on game quality and user experience. The £2 max bet rule also protects the casino from high-stakes players who might clear the wagering too quickly with a single lucky spin. It’s a carefully balanced system designed to be fair to players while maintaining profitability for the business.
